Nanotechnology in Water Purification


Nanotechnology is revolutionizing the field of water purification by providing innovative solutions to remove contaminants and pollutants from water. This Professional Certificate program is designed for professionals and individuals who want to enhance their knowledge and skills in this emerging field.

The program focuses on the application of nanomaterials and nanotechnology in water treatment, including removal of heavy metals, pesticides, and other pollutants. It also covers topics such as nanofiltration, nanoclay, and other advanced technologies used in water purification.
